Output 2b95b86103136cef67e3d08609de453f6b129ec68b28d31495260c7f3e01a31e:0

value
51992850
script pubkey
OP_0 OP_PUSHBYTES_20 952f150242818b5c246fbec7df28e750639cd9a2
address
bc1qj5h32qjzsx94cfr0hmra72882p3eekdzkf9dnn
transaction
2b95b86103136cef67e3d08609de453f6b129ec68b28d31495260c7f3e01a31e